Good Morning, today is Thursday, July 14.

🌊 On this day in 1966, Singer, songwriter, and guitarist Tanya Donelly was born in Newport.

🌊 The Mooring, Boat House, Coast Guard House, and Los Andes are among OpenTable’s “100 Best Restaurants for Outdoor Dining”.

🌊 The Harvest Fair is returning to Norman Bird Sanctuary in October.

🌊 We caught up with Ballroom Thieves about their new album and upcoming performance at Newport Folk Festival.

🌊 Today is the Quarterfinals at the Infosys Hall of Fame Open. Today will include two singles matches and four doubles matches. Gates open at 10 am, and tennis begins at 11 am.

🌊 The Preservation Society of Newport County will open its Gilded Age Summer Lecture Series today at 6 pm with “The Whole Gilded Age: Newport and Beyond,” by Ulysses Grant Dietz.

🌊 Local musicians Ed Nary and Tom Perrotti are hosting a performance by Claudia Russell and Bruce Kaplan at Thriving Tea Coffeehouse today at 6 pm.

🌊 Celebrate Doris Duke’s affinity for jazz music and Newport’s special connection to the art form at Jazz On The Lawn at Rough Point today at 6 pm.

🌊 newportFILM will present The Yin and Yang of Gerry Lopez at Safe Harbor New England Boatworks in Portsmouth tonight at 8:25 pm.
